At Swarmaanas, I realized long ago that singing alone is good, but singing together is therapeutic. My classes are structured to foster a non-judgmental environment, which is why I started the Singathon competition to help students move from the classroom to a real stage.
Our community is diverse. We have participants from age 15 to 80, including writers, police officers, teachers, and students. When you join, you are not just a student; you become part of a support system. We focus on:
- Stage Confidence: Getting comfortable with the mic and performing in front of a live audience.
- Shared Growth: Learning from peers during our group karaoke sessions.
- Giving Back: We often host events for causes, such as our Singathon seasons which have raised funds for martyrs' families.
Whether you want to join our weekly recreational group or aim for the annual stage performance, you will find a welcoming space. We keep our groups small to ensure everyone gets attention. You can join us for online batches from anywhere or visit our studio in Dadar, Mumbai. The goal is simple: sing, be happy, and share that joy.
